The Reds are set to welcome back Conor Bradley from suspension, after he served a one-match ban against Brighton & Hove Albion last weekend.But having bemoaned having only 13 available senior outfield players for the clash with the Seagulls, Slot’s hand will be forced even more against Spurs despite Bradley’s return.Joe Gomez and Dominik Szoboszlai both limped off against Brighton with hamstring and ankle injuries respectively, while the Reds will also be without Mohamed Salah after he departed for Africa Cup of Nations duty.READ MORE: Mohamed Salah sent FSG warning as former Liverpool CEO shares theory on his 'fiery' agentREAD MORE: Crystal Palace boss Oliver Glasner deals Liverpool Marc Guehi transfer blow as Reds blamedWhile Szoboszlai faces an outside chance of being fit for the trip to North London, Liverpool could find themselves without as many as seven senior players for Saturday’s game at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ium.They are not the only side affected by enforced absences though, with Thomas Frank also facing up to the prospect of being without eight of his players for the game.With Slot set to offer an injury update at his pre-match press conference at 9.45am on Friday morning, the ECHO takes a look at which players are currently at risk of missing the weekend’s match…LIVERPOOLGiovanni Leoni - ACLThe Italian suffered an ACL injury on his debut against Southampton back in September. Undergoing surgery, he has been ruled out for the season.Jeremie Frimpong - HamstringFrimpong has been sidelined since the end of October after suffering his second hamstring injury of the season against Eintracht Frankfurt.



The Netherlands international is closing in on a return though, with Slot recently confirming he is expected to soon return to team training.As a result, if passed fit, he could return to the matchday squad against Tottenham.
